I have had the same problem with an '02 Xterra--twice. Solution: at the end of the wiper arm, nearest the cowl, where the arm attaches to the shaft exiting the cowl there is a plastic cover. This cover looks like it is a fixed part of the wiper arm but WRONG! It is easily removed with a little prying. Beneath this cover is a nut (about 1/2 inch) which holds the wiper arm to the shaft. Place the wipers in the PARKED position, rotate the loose arm to the PARKED position and tighten this nut. I used a very small amount of blue thread lock on the nut before tightening. I didn't use the thread lock the first time I had this problem and am sure this is the reason for the repeat problem.

However, if this didn't fix your problem then you have problem with one or both of the connecting linkages under the black plastic hood cover between your hood and front windshield. This is a frequent problem for Xterras in the winter and spring due to icy weather and a poor design by Nissan--plastic fittings connecting the linkages. The part numbers for my 2000 Xterra were 28842-S3801 (connects the two wipers for synchronized operation) and 28841-3S500 (connects the passenger side wiper to the wiper motor for operation) and I believe these numbers will work for your '02/'03 as well. You will need a flat tip screwdriver to pry up the plastic covers protecting the wiper arm nuts, a 12mm socket and ratchet to remove the nuts, a Phillips head screwdriver, and perhaps a removal tool for plastic snap-in connectors (optional). First, remove both plastic covers and remove the securing nuts and wiper arms (leave blades attached) then unscrew your radio antenna. Next, use your flat tip screw driver and pry up the little black cover/cup on your radio antenna. Next, raise and secure your hood and gently remove the black rubber foam padding tube between the hood and the cowl. (Note: the pad is secured to the car by little plastic connectors so use a tool or be gentle detaching them). Next, lift off the passenger's side portion of the cowl (it snaps right out and will go back in easily) and then the driver's side portion. Next, unscrew the 3 screws securing the black plastic linkage cover to the frame and remove the cover in order to see all of the connections. The linkage arms connect to the ball joints at each end by plastic sockets that can easily detach or break during cold weather. First, see if you can reattach the socket to the joint (simply by pushing the plastic socket onto the metal ball joint) and then turn on your wiper motor to see if this fixes the problem. If not, then you will have to replace the broken link assembly because the plastic sockets are press manufactured in the link assembly. To do this just use your flat tip to pry-off/disconnect the socket at the other end of the assembly and install the new one by pushing its sockets onto the ball joints. Once reconnected, turn on the wiper motor to ensure it works and then reassemble your truck by reversing the above dissassembly instructions. (Note: once your wipers are back on, ensure they are properly positioned before you completely tighten down the 12-mm securing nut.)
